        Subject:        Science apparatus for The University of The Gambia

        Apeal to the University of The Gambia.  Please deal with this
quickly!!

        A friend of mine, ALAN WELCH who lives at Normal Heightrs, Chiltern
Road, Amersham, Buckinghamshire HP6  5PH, England (Tel & Fax +44 (0) 1494
726 861) runs a voluntary charity called LABAID.  He collects unwanted
science apparatus (not chemicals) from schools and universities in the UK,
and where he can he makes it available to schools and universities overseas.


        There is a container going to The Gambia quite soon, and it may be
possible to put science apparatus in it for The University of The Gambia if
this would be helpful.

        Please can someone contact a staff member at the University of The
Gambia and tell them of this possibility.  They should then either contact
Alan Welch direct by telephone or fax email, or if this is difficult, they
could contact me and I will pass on the message.

        There may be a small charge, because the goods have to be carried to
the town where the container is being loaded, but it will only be small.
